DIY Tiered confectionery stands
Friday, 20 December 2013 09:51 pm![[personal profile]](https://www.dreamwidth.org/img/silk/identity/user.png)
While doing some Christmas shopping, the hubbs and I came across a cute little 3-tier cake stand for roughly $50. I loved it, but being as frugal as I am… I just couldn’t justify the cost. We do entertain fairly frequently and I wanted something similar, but I put it on the back burner until I could find something cheaper. Well, cheaper ended up being $25 at Goodwill and a glue gun. I was running errands this morning and decided to pop on over to Goodwill since it was along my route. A few cute pieces of dishware, some vases, and some glass candlestick holders later I walked out carrying the basis for five different confectionery stands. Mine aren’t perfect, and most of them have a slight tilt, or aren’t exactly level, but considering the small cost and amount of time to make them, I’m not at all bothered by it.
